Common Queries About LMS

Can I use an LMS for free?

Yes, open-source LMS solutions like Moodle are available.

What industries use LMS?

Education, corporate training, healthcare, and e-learning businesses commonly use LMS platforms.

Do I need technical skills to use an LMS?

Most LMS platforms are user-friendly, requiring minimal technical knowledge.

How do I monetize my online course with an LMS?

LMS platforms support monetization features.

Can small businesses use an LMS?

Absolutely! Many LMS solutions cater to small businesses with affordable plans.
